Anke Fierlinger is a scholar working on Rheumatology, Surgery and Orthopedics and Sports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Anke Fierlinger has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Rheumatology, 7 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ine. Recurrent topics in Anke Fierlinger’s work include Osteoarthritis Treatment and Mechanisms (10 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(4 papers) and Bone fractures and treatments (4 papers). Anke Fierlinger is often cited by papers focused on Osteoarthritis Treatment and Mechanisms (10 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(4 papers) and Bone fractures and treatments (4 papers). Anke Fierlinger coll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and India. Anke Fierlinger's co-authors include Faizan Niazi, Mathew Nicholls, Robin Altman, Ajay Manjoo, Harry K. Genant, Roy D. Altman, Antonio Nino, Per Aspenberg, Bruce Mitlak and Christopher Recknor and has published in prestigious journals such as Radiology, Journal of Bone and Mineral Research and Journal of Orthopaedic Research®.
